TEST #3a: Thermal Fuse
The thermal fuse is wired in series with the
dryer drive motor.
1. Unplug dryer or disconnect power.
2. Access the thermal fuse by removing
the front access panel. Thermal Fuse is
located on blower housing.
3. Using an ohmmeter, check the
connuity across the thermal fuse.
¾ If the ohmmeter indicates an open circuit, replace the
thermal fuse.
TEST #3b: Thermal Cut-O
(Electric Dryer)
If the dryer does not produce heat, check the status of the
thermal cut-o.
1. Unplug dryer or disconnect power.
2. Access the thermal cut-o by removing the front access
panel. Thermal Cut-O (and High Limit Thermostat) is
located on the heater element housing.
3. Using an ohmmeter, check the connuity across the
thermal cut-o.
4. If the ohmmeter indicates an open circuit, perform the
following:
Replace both the thermal cut-o and high limit
thermostat (see gure below). In addion, check for
blocked or improper exhaust system and heat element
malfuncon.
High Limit Thermostat (L), Thermal Cut-O (R)

TEST #3d: Inline Thermal Fuse
(Gas Dryer)
1. Unplug dryer or disconnect power.
2. Access the inline thermal fuse by removing the rear panel.
3. Using an ohmmeter, check the connuity from the red/
white lead on the operang thermostat to the red/white
lead on the high limit thermostat.
¾ If the ohmmeter indicates an open circuit, replace the
harness. The inline thermal fuse is not repairable.
